Many phlebotomists who work on the road, are certified through nationally established agencies, such as the American Society for Clinical Pathology (ASCP), the American Phlebotomy Association (APA), or the National Center for Competency Testing (NCCT). Within the rapidly growing healthcare business, employment of clinical lab technicians (which includes phlebotomists) is anticipated to increase 14 percent from 2006 to 2016--faster compared to the average for all professions. The increase in new jobs is due to increasing population as well as the development of new lab evaluations.
